游戏引擎在现代游戏制作中扮演着重要的角色,它是构建、开发和管理游戏的技术核心。研究动画系统的骨骼动画、蒙皮、插值算法等方面,可以提高角色动画的表现力和流畅度。深入研究这些工具和编辑器的功能和使用方法,可以提高游戏制作的效率和质量。
游戏引擎在现代游戏制作中扮演着重要的角色,它是构建、开发和管理游戏的技术核心。了解和深入研究游戏引擎可以帮助游戏制作团队更好地理解和应用相关技术,提高游戏的开发效率和质量。
以下是游戏引擎研究的一些深入探讨方面:
1. 游戏引擎架构:了解游戏引擎的整体架构是深入研究的第一步。游戏引擎通常由图形引擎、物理引擎、声音引擎、动画引擎等模块构成,研究这些模块的交互方式和优化策略可以更好地理解游戏引擎的工作原理。
2. 图形渲染:游戏引擎的图形渲染模块负责将游戏世界中的3D模型、材质、光照等信息转化为最终的图像。深入研究图形渲染技术,包括渲染管线、着色器、阴影、后处理等方面,可以帮助开发者优化游戏的视觉效果和性能。
3. 物理模拟:物理引擎是游戏引擎的重要组成部分,它可以模拟游戏中的重力、碰撞、刚体等物理效果。了解物理引擎的工作原理和常用算法,可以帮助开发者更好地处理游戏中的物理交互,使游戏更加真实和可靠。
4. 动画系统:动画引擎可以实现游戏中的人物和物体的自然运动。研究动画系统的骨骼动画、蒙皮、插值算法等方面,可以提高角色动画的表现力和流畅度。
5. 声音引擎:声音引擎可以实现游戏中的音效和音乐。深入研究声音引擎的工作原理和音频处理技术,可以提高游戏的音效质量和音频性能。
6. 网络和多人游戏:多人游戏的技术要求更高,需要处理网络通信、同步、延迟等问题。研究网络技术和多人游戏引擎可以帮助开发者实现稳定、流畅的多人游戏体验。
7. 工具和编辑器:游戏引擎通常提供了可视化的工具和编辑器,用于游戏资源管理、关卡设计、脚本编写等。深入研究这些工具和编辑器的功能和使用方法,可以提高游戏制作的效率和质量。
深入研究游戏引擎的技术核心可以帮助游戏开发者更好地理解和应用相关技术,从而提高游戏制作的效率和质量,实现更出色的游戏作品。